Keyword bookmarks are a way of opening popular sites from the address bar by entering just few characters. For example, I can set it so that if I type 'r' and hit enter, I'll be taken to the Reddit home page.

In Firefox, adding keyword bookmarks is pretty straightforward: http://www.lifehacker.com.au/2009/04/how-to-set-up-firefox-keyword-bookmarks/ . But in Chrome, it's more complicated: http://lifehacker.com/5476033/how-to-set-keyword-bookmarks-in-google-chrome

Anyway, I use keyword bookmarks for all the sites I commonly visit. This problem could easily be solved if you could give an option in Vrome to just have 'o' do the same thing that ctrl+l does in Chrome by default (this would be nice anyway because it would also enable access to history/bookmark search).
